Fire crews rescue a horse trapped in a ditch in Bromyard

A HORSE which ended up in a ditch in Stoke Lacy near Bromyard was rescued by fire crews.

Hereford and Worcester Fire and Rescue Service’s large animal rescue team from Bromyard and a crew from Hereford were called to the A465 at 11.44am this morning.

A woman was riding the horse when it was spooked by a rider.

The animal ended up on its side in a ditch and, after the rider raised the alarm, the firefighters were quickly on the scene.




Specialist equipment was used and a local farmer with a telehandler and under the supervision of a vet, the horse was sedated and then brought to safety.

The animal was then taken to a nearby stables and has now made a full recovery.


Following the incident drivers have been urged to limit their speed to a maximum of 15mph when passing a horse.
